The 34-day-long strike by veterinary students of Guru Angad Dev Veterinary and Animal Sciences University (GADVASU), Ludhiana, concluded following an official meeting with Punjab Finance Minister Harpal Singh Cheema.
During the meeting, the minister assured the students that the internship stipend for veterinary interns would be increased from ?15,000 to ?22,000 per month on a par with BDS and MBBS interns of the state.
He further committed that an official notification confirming the enhancement would be issued before November 12.
The meeting was also attended by senior government officials, including Rahul Bhandari, Principal Secretary, Animal Husbandry; Sarvjit Singh, Special Chief Secretary, Department of Sports and Youth Welfare; Shawkat Ahmad, Special Secretary, Finance; Dr Paramdeep Singh Walia, Director, Animal Husbandry Department; and Dr Jatinderpaul Singh Gill, Vice-Chancellor, GADVASU.
Students were represented by Dr Avneet Jassal, Dr Kamalpreet Singh, Dr Sunil Momi and Dr Muskan Thakur, who conveyed that the decision to call off the protest was made following the formal assurance from the Finance Minister and attending officials.
